State Regulations for Registered Agents

All province features distinct registered agent requirements that organizations must comply with when creating an LLC or corporation. Usually, the registered agent must possess a physical address in the state of incorporation, known as the registered office, where lawful documents can be received. This site cannot be a P.O. Box and must be reachable during standard business hours. Some regions may also enable the use of a business registered agent service, which provides a designated address for legal documents.

In addition to possessing a physical address, registered agents must be an person resident of the state or a registered agent company authorized to do business there. Some states require registered agents to be available to accept service of process at all times, while others may allow for restricted availability. It is crucial for businesses to check the eligibility of their chosen registered agent, ensuring they meet all region-specific qualifications.

Inability to comply with state requirements for registered agents can cause significant penalties, including financial sanctions or the inability to conduct business within the law within the region. As such, understanding the nuances of registered agent laws is vital for ensuring adherence and guaranteeing the smooth functioning of your business.

Suggestions for Changing Your Registered Agent

Alterating your registered agent can be a clear-cut process if you follow specific guidelines. First, start by reviewing your current registered agent agreement to grasp the conditions of termination and the required notice periods. It’s crucial to make sure that you comply with these requirements to avoid any disruptions in your business operations. Additionally, research available registered agent services to find one that fulfills your needs, whether you’re in search of cost-effectiveness, reliability, or extra services like compliance reminders.

Once you have picked a new registered agent, you will need to formally notify your current agent of your intent to change. This communication can usually be done through a formal communication method such as a letter or an electronic message, depending on the rules specified in your current agreement. Together with this communication, you should also prepare the required forms or documentation required by your state’s laws to legally change your registered agent.

Finally, after submitting your change of registered agent documentation to the appropriate state authority, verify that this change has been acknowledged. You may want to ask for a receipt of confirmation or look at the official state business portal for updates. Keeping detailed records of all correspondence and confirmations will help ensure that your business complies with registered agent rules and maintains its good standing.
